Dutton Ranch Season 2 Officially Confirmed With New Story Details

Paramount has officially greenlit Dutton Ranch Season 2, giving fans another installment in the saga of Beth Dutton and Rip Wheeler. The news of the renewal came before the Season 1 finale because the Yellowstone spinoff broke streaming records. Paramount announced a new season for the series, calling the show one of the streaming service’s biggest original hits, and the dramatic finale has already set up several major storylines for the next installment.

Dutton Ranch Season 2 Renewal Officially Announced

The streaming platform said the series attracted 12.9 million viewers worldwide in its first seven days, the biggest original launch in Paramount+ history. The premiere also drew nearly 2.9 million viewers on Paramount Network, showing that the Yellowstone universe is still attracting a big audience across streaming and television. This early renewal was thanks to a strong response from viewers, which means Beth and Rip’s journey will continue.

What the Season 1 Finale Means for Dutton Ranch Season 2

Dutton Ranch season two premise leaves many questions unanswered in season one finale. The biggest unresolved storyline is that Carter is kidnapped by cartel leader Mariano, which puts Beth and Rip in an even more precarious position. Rob-Will’s death, bizarre and the escalating violence at 10 Petal Ranch, show the fight in Texas is just beginning. The finale doesn’t close the story, it opens the door for bigger battles, emotional decisions and new enemies next season.

New Showrunner Brings a Fresh Direction

And there’s going to be a big creative change behind the scenes for Season 2 as well. Chad Feehan has stepped down as show runner, and Benjamin Cavell is the new show runner. Cavell has a track record of successful TV dramas and his appointment indicates a new creative direction while keeping the show focused on Beth, Rip and Carter. Paramount has not released any plot details, but the new leadership is expected to influence the tone and scale of the next season.

Dutton Ranch Season 2 Release Date Expectations

Paramount has officially renewed Dutton Ranch for another season however, there isn’t a release date yet for season 2. Production is expected to begin on the show with the new creative team, and the series has been much anticipated by several in the industry to return at some point in 2027. Paramount has not yet issued an official production schedule so it is unclear when it will premiere. Fans can keep streaming season 1 as they await casting announcements and filming updates.
